Output e998c55c96e8336902abc2b7fb70f3558b1aa75208e1dac3f89a5e9bf1276bdd:6

value
5007096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90a5336917e7090948a256c95b49183c11ce6e1 OP_EQUAL
address
3JZRJRsByjXMBwwT32rWhBR2uJFvKVxXHm
transaction
e998c55c96e8336902abc2b7fb70f3558b1aa75208e1dac3f89a5e9bf1276bdd
confirmations
283932
spent
true